WebOct 20, 2024 · Aerospace engineering is deeply rooted in theoretical physics, fluid dynamics, aerodynamics, the equations of motion, and flight dynamics. An aerospace engineering major combines knowledge of these different fields and applies it to the design, development, testing, and production of aircraft, spacecraft, and related technologies.
